Twelve days after the triple stabbing and murder on 14th Street between First Avenue and Avenue A, the East Village block has returned to a quiet place where businesses, vendors, and their employees can go about their daily lives without living in fear that one of them will become a statistic. 

The NYPD has maintained a constant presence on the block since the murder involving illegal street vendors and many are grateful they continually check in with local businesses. 

An article in Our Town makes note the situation, quoting the befuddled City Council member Carlina Rivera who said, "we are also upset that this area remains chaotic and unkempt since the pandemic." 

Rivera's failure to handle the situation for seven years is why the area has remained chaotic and unkempt, something she and her office should really stop drawing attention to with vacuous quotes. Her office hasn't offered any statistics on her 'Street health, outreach, and wellness' initiative, aptly named SHOW, but Carlina Rivera did manage to find the time to casually pose on the blood stains.
